Girl Scouts sending cookies to troops

by WFAA

wfaa.com

Posted on March 18, 2010 at 8:17 AM

CARROLLTON - The Girl Scouts of Texas Oklahoma Plains has teamed up with Airborne Angel Cadets of Carrollton to ship 1,400 cases of Girl Scout Cookies to service men and women as part of Project Troop to Troop.

Scouts and volunteers were on hand Thursday morning to help move the cookies. Through Project Troop to Troop, customers may purchase additional packages of Girl Scout Cookies that will be delivered directly to members of the U.S. Armed forces.

Girl Scouts of Texas Oklahoma Plains works with the military and non-profit organizations to deliver Girl Scout Cookies to service men and women. In 2009, over 29,000 packages of Girl Scout Cookies were delivered around the globe.
